const ThemeContext = React.createContext('light'); 原理:用 { } 实现局部作用域的全局变量 7 使用脚手架创建 React 项目 Create-React-App 1 包含: Babel、Webpack、Jest、ESLint 2 是入门级的,最简策略 Rekit 1 包含: Redux、Router、Less、Feature Oriented Architecture、Dedicated IDE http://Codesandbox...
在我们学习JavaScript的时候,我们学习了一个bootstrap的组件库。可以让我们快速开发,但是我们现在学习了 React ,一种组件化编程方式,很少说会去贴大量的 HTML 代码,再配一下CSS,JS。我们也有一些现成的组件库可以使用,我们只需要写一个组件标签即可调用。这让我们 React 开发变得十分的快速,方便和整洁。 我们这里学...
DOCTYPEhtml>Hello React!// React code will go here复制代码 在编写本文的时,我加载的库是稳定版本的。 React-React顶级API React DOM- 添加特定于DOM的方法 Babel-JavaScript编辑器,使我们可以在旧的浏览
这是一个 React 元素:const div = React.createElement('div', ...)(注意 d 小写) 这是一个 React 组件:const Div = () => React.createElement('div', ...)(注意 D 大写) 注意大小写,这是一个「不成文的规定」 2. 什么是 React 组件 能够跟其他物件组合起来的物件,就是组件 组件并没有明确的...
《React学习手册实践练习》:https://blog.csdn.net/nmj2008/article/details/115356376 第1章 初识React React是--款用于创建用户界面的流行库。它是Facebook为了辅助数据驱动的大型网站解决某些问题而研发的。2013年React刚发布时,该项目受到了外界的一-些质疑,因为React的技术规范非常独特。
Context 没那么好用,React 官方也没什么最佳实践,于是一个个社区库就诞生了。 目前比较常用的状态管理方式有hooks、redux、mobx三种。 一、组件通信 (1).组件的特点 组件是独立且封闭的单元,默认情况下,只能使用组件自己的数据 在组件化过程中,通常会将一个完整的功能拆分成多个组件,以更好的完成整个应用的功能 ...
react是面向数据编程,不需要直接去控制dom,你只要把数据操作好,react自己会去帮你操作dom,可以节省很多操作dom的代码。这就是声明式开发。 命令式编程描述代码如何工作,告诉计算机一步步地执行、先做什么后做什么,在执行完之前,计算机并不知道我要做什么,为什么这么做.它只是一步一步地执行了。
5. 深入学习React 以上只是React的入门指南,您还有很多东西要学习和探索。您可以了解更多关于组件、状态管理、路由、API调用等方面的知识,以构建更复杂和功能丰富的React应用程序。 为了更好地学习React,我建议您阅读官方文档,并尝试编写一些小型项目。通过不断地练习和探索,您将逐渐掌握React的技能,并成为一名熟练的Rea...
React是一种流行的JavaScript库,被广泛应用于构建现代、可交互的用户界面。学习React不仅是掌握前端开发的关键,还可以帮助您构建可维护、可扩展的应用程序。本文将为您提供学习React的详细讲解说明,通过丰富的代码示例帮助您深入理解React的核心概念和用法,并给出一些建议,助您快速掌握React并应用于实际项目中。一、...
React的一个特点是需要编写JSX文件进行项目的编写,所以在MVC的视图文件中需要引用对应的JSX文件。4. 通过对JSX文件的编写完成对页面的渲染,开始你的React之旅。这一篇先导文主要是介绍怎么从零开始搭建React项目,以上的步骤是自己踩完各种坑之后能给成功走通这一条路的步骤,也算是对自己学习的一个总结。接下去...